Specific Troubleshooting Guide for 3500/40M Proximitor Monitor

This troubleshooting guide provides solutions for common issues encountered with the 3500/40M Proximitor Monitor.

Common Issues and Solutions

Issue: Monitor not powering on

Possible Causes:

  • Power supply failure
  • Improper connections

Recommended Solutions:

  1. Check power supply connections
  2. Test power supply voltage
Issue: Incorrect vibration readings

Possible Causes:

  • Faulty transducer
  • Improper configuration

Recommended Solutions:

  1. Inspect and replace transducer if necessary
  2. Verify configuration settings in the software
Issue: Alarms not triggering

Possible Causes:

  • Setpoints not configured correctly
  • Signal conditioning issues

Recommended Solutions:

  1. Reconfigure alarm setpoints using the software
  2. Check signal conditioning settings

Advanced Diagnostic Notes

For advanced diagnostics, utilize the 3500 Rack Configuration Software to analyze signal integrity and monitor performance metrics.
